Output 0ecfc5060e84b9168521d74a52519ed3f33a2b9059326fce731bda36ef7549f9:11

value
6884603
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 489bbe43dea8708bbdd8071676082a9ae06c6015580bf74b799136f30373466f
address
bc1pfzdmus774pcgh0wcqut8vzp2ntsxccq4tq9lwjmejym0xqmngehs88mcrv
transaction
0ecfc5060e84b9168521d74a52519ed3f33a2b9059326fce731bda36ef7549f9
spent
true